Transaction 505cc2aeba5bc77bcd1bde46956784120caeb055d5c1fa7480795c29bf91f130

1 Input
2 Outputs
  • 505cc2aeba5bc77bcd1bde46956784120caeb055d5c1fa7480795c29bf91f130:0
  • value  135239
    address  1FFF8T8WUh4yZyAdErgMgKnwzjozEPu3Xo
  • 505cc2aeba5bc77bcd1bde46956784120caeb055d5c1fa7480795c29bf91f130:1
  • value  720964
    address  3KtsFDC1fw8mHtdN9sNJtFigTBzpYpUTLX